Podcast Topic:

Black men arent allowed to grieve like others. We are taught to be a man and not to show our feelings but the more we hold those feelings in the worst it gets and we find other ways to release our hurt and most of the time its in a bad way which further black mens sterotypes. Lets talk about it.
